Abstract

A damping resin composition contains: 100 parts by weight of a polymer blend of 40 to 70% by weight of a polypropylene resin and 30 to 60% by weight of a thermoplastic elastomer; and 5 to 60 parts by weight of an inorganic filler, the thermoplastic elastomer comprising at least one member selected from the group consisting of an elastomer having a Tg of 0° C. to 20° C. and an elastomer having a Tg of −20° C. to 0° C. and an ethylene-&agr;-olefin copolymer. Using this damping resin compostion, a vehicle rocker-panel molding, which is attached to the lower part of a vehicle side body is molded. The rocker-panel molding has a bottom section and a side section substantially perpendicular to the bottom section and having prescribed rigidity, showing a nearly L-shaped crosswise profile, in which the bottom section is thinner than the side section so that vibration energy generated on foreign matter's striking against the rocker-panel molding is forcibly converted to heat energy by the thinner bottom section thereby to suppress transmission of noise to the space of the automobile.
